MOPAC harness — design spec v0 (2026-08-28)
A Go headless agent harness for the RCEO/TSG org. Replaces bash/screen/file-hack inner loop. All patterns established 2026-08-28 STAY; only the substrate changes. References: ../reference/{crush,maki}; siblings to port: ../siblings/{KNEL-AIMiddleware, KNELSecretsManager}.
What it is NOT
- Not a TUI. Inner loop = pull Redmine -> run turn -> write Discourse/Redmine back -> chain next turn. Humans observe via files/Redmine/Discourse, not by attaching to the loop.
- Not a daemon. Bounded turns chaining (drip), same as dispatch-turn.sh today.
Core loop (from DESIGN-24x7-execution.md, carried over)
- INTAKE: poll released scope (Redmine query) + local inbox files.
- GATE: semaphore (LLM slots, class-aware: llm-heavy|compute-long|hybrid), budget from LiteLLM usage API (http://192.168.3.78:4001) — virtual key per stack, hard caps enforced at proxy.
- EXECUTE: bounded turn, fresh small context, tools below.
- WRITEBACK: REPORT file + Redmine issue note (SoR). Discourse for docs.
- CHAIN: completion triggers next conductor iteration. P1 first, grinders chunked, compute-long tasks run in non-LLM slots.
- ESCALATE: anything outside standing-release scope -> TASK file -> founder gate. Never auto-executes.
Tools (port from crush/KNEL, Go)
- bash exec, file edit (tree-sitter-aware parses; see maki's approach),
redmine-cli, discourse-cli, tea (gitea), docker, bitwarden (replace
KNELSecretsManager with Go bwraper around
bwCLI; secrets never in logs). - MCP client (crush's mcp plumbing is the reference; wrappers exist in siblings/KNEL-AIMiddleware — port config format for compat).
- LSP: port lsp-* wrappers or embed go.lsp devkit.
- Permission model: per-tool allow/deny, tree-sitter bash parsing (maki reference) — subshells/pipes handled; org preset: no sudo/ssh/network exfil; writes confined to declared roots.
Providers
- OpenAI-compatible only, pointed at LiteLLM (base_url + virtual key). OAuth flows (crush-style) OUT of scope for v1 — proxy key is enough.
- Retry/backoff on stream truncation (z.ai "Message content shorter than read bytes" seen 2x today) with turn resume.
Cross-host (5 onstage + 3 offstage)
- Each host runs harness instances; coordination via _crossfeed files (v1) and/or LiteLLM keys as the global budget broker. Event receiver (T1) later.
Build order (go slow, grinder TASKs, quota-aware)
- Reference studies: crush oauth/mcp/session code; maki permission parsing + token-reduction (index/tool_search). Deliverable: PORTING-NOTES.md each.
- harness skeleton: config, loop, redmine-pull, file writeback, exec tool.
- Permission layer + bitwarden wrapper.
- LiteLLM integration + semaphore/budget gates.
- MCP/LSP ports.
- Pilot: one RCEO stack on trivial released scope; compare vs drip loop.
Constraints
- Quota: grinder turns only, no idle polling loops, compact aggressively.
- Never log secret values; keys from bitwarden at runtime.
- Everything it does lands in git (tooling repos) or Redmine (work records).
